Title: The Innovative Mind of Piero Furlan
Introduction
Piero Furlan, a talented inventor based in Treviso, Italy, has made significant contributions to the field of chemical processes with an impressive portfolio of 10 patents. His innovative work primarily focuses on catalysis and purification methods, showcasing his expertise and dedication to advancing chemical technologies.
Latest Patents
Among his latest patents, Furlan developed a "Process for the activation of zeolitic catalysts containing titanium and their use in oxidation reactions." This patent details a sophisticated process that activates zeolitic catalysts with a specific titanium formula. By treating these materials with a solution of an ammonium salt of a carboxylic acid followed by calcination, Furlan enhances the catalytic performance of these materials in oxidation processes of organic substrates.
Another notable invention is the "Purification method of Cyclohexanone-oxime." This method involves washing cyclohexanone-oxime solutions using water or an aqueous solution of a base with a pK<5. Additionally, it includes passing the solutions through a weakly alkaline ion exchange resin and, optionally, through a weakly acidic ion exchange resin, improving the overall purity of the substance.
Career Highlights
Furlan's career includes vital positions at companies known for their commitment to chemical innovations. He worked at Enichem S.p.a and Montedipe S.r.l., where he honed his skills and applied his inventive mindset to real-world challenges in the industry.
